Maanshan fest honors ancient Anhui poet

By Zhang Zhao | China Daily | Updated: 2013-10-14 06:57

To commemorate one of China's greatest poets, the 25th China Li Bai Poetry Festival kicked off on Oct 13 in Maanshan, Anhui province.

Li Bai (AD 701-762), lived and died in the locale that would later be called Maanshan, where he wrote about 60 famous poems and essays.

Many other ancient Chinese poets and writers also lived in the area and created works that are today used in textbooks.
